M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
talks about
issues
regarding open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
digital education technology are providing the means for
people
all around the world
to take classes online.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
blended learning organizations
have to deal with
more than ever because online lear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
How can educators
certify that
the training provided by these
MOOC courses is
acceptable?
How can we
certify that
teachers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C classes?
What business models are being used by
organizations like
Udemy to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can institutions
handle problems like
poor
learner motivation and high
student dropout rates?
